動作確認のお願い

フォーラム(掲示板)ルール
フォーラム(掲示板)ルールはこちら  ※コードを貼り付ける場合は [code][/code] で囲って下さい。詳しくはこちら
dic
記事: 656
登録日時: 13年前
住所: 宮崎県
連絡を取る:

動作確認のお願い

#1

投稿記事 by dic » 5年前

ツールができたのですが、友人の環境ではエラーがでて
実行できなかったそうです。
ネットカフェでも実行できなかったです。

何が原因かわからないので、どんなエラーがでるか
試していただけませんか?

ダウンロードが始まるので途中でxボタンで終了できます。

開発環境はWin10では友人はWin7だったそうです。
特別な関数は用いていないので、動くはずなのですが・・・
添付ファイル
tool2_v1.2.zip
(182.34 KiB) ダウンロード数: 133 回

Bull
記事: 149
登録日時: 9年前

Re: 動作確認のお願い

#2

投稿記事 by Bull » 5年前

実行はしていないのですが、デバッグモードでビルドされているようです。
リリースモードでビルドすれば、開発環境以外でも動くようになるのではないでしょうか。

それと、できたプログラムを配布するときは、リリースモードでもデバッグできないようにプロジェクトのプロパティーを変更した方がいいですよ。

アバター
みけCAT
記事: 6734
登録日時: 13年前
住所: 千葉県
連絡を取る:

Re: 動作確認のお願い

#3

投稿記事 by みけCAT » 5年前

環境:Windows 7 Home Premium Service Pack 1 (64ビット)
「コンピューターに MSVCP140D.dll がないため、プログラムを開始できません。」というエラーが出ました。
mixcpp-3-20539-20190131.png
エラー
mixcpp-3-20539-20190131.png (22.82 KiB) 閲覧数: 3891 回
Dependency Walkerでチェックしたところ、他にも
VCRUNTIME140D.DLLおよびUCRTBASED.DLLが使用されており、自分の環境には無いようでした。
複雑な問題?マシンの性能を上げてOpenMPで殴ればいい!(死亡フラグ)

Bull
記事: 149
登録日時: 9年前

Re: 動作確認のお願い

#4

投稿記事 by Bull » 5年前

#2 に追加ですが、ランタイムライブラリーが必要ですね。

Microsoft Visual C++ 再頒布可能パッケージ
これをインストールするようにご友人にお伝えください。

または、スタティックリンクするようにプロジェクトを変更すれば、ランタイムライブラリのインストールは必要なくなります。

dic
記事: 656
登録日時: 13年前
住所: 宮崎県
連絡を取る:

Re: 動作確認のお願い

#5

投稿記事 by dic » 5年前

Bullさん、みけCATさん
さっそくの返答ありがとうございます。
再頒布可能パッケージを薦めてみました。
アドバイスありがとうございました。

Math

Re: 動作確認のお願い

#6

投稿記事 by Math » 5年前

Visual Studio 2017でインストーラが作成できるらしいので参考まで。

https://www.osadasoft.com/visual-studio ... %E6%88%90/

返信

“C言語何でも質問掲示板” へ戻る